MINISTERS MUST EXPLAIN FOOT AND MOUTH REPORT DELAY - HUHNE12.00.00am GMT Tue 7th Aug 2007
Commenting on today's developments in the foot and mouth outbreak, Liberal Democrat Shadow Defra Secretary, Chris Huhne MP said: "The latest confirmed case is obviously worrying news. It is imperative that the source of this disease is discovered as soon as possible. "Ministers must explain why the Health and Safety Executive report has been unexpectedly delayed. I hope no ministerial editing of its conclusions takes place. "Much more effort must be made to ensure footpaths are closed to limit the possibility of any further spread. "Defra must also give greater information to local farmers on what they can and cannot do. For example, there has been no direction on the use of combine harvesters, despite weather which is perfect for harvesting."
